Output 07e07ac52f81bb7e293bac45ad2524139a9553ebca26df5f367014ea1ea58bcb:0

value
22660707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ba85f4e2139d61de97660ce058f61e8e2a995e59 OP_EQUAL
address
3JhG5gz3xn9NyKFYUzkRbJZLD8CdbP2RHM
transaction
07e07ac52f81bb7e293bac45ad2524139a9553ebca26df5f367014ea1ea58bcb
spent
true